The Carpenter's Gift: A Christmas Tale about the Rockefeller Center Tree is not just a story; it's a heartwarming journey into the very spirit of Christmas. David Rubel masterfully weaves a narrative that transcends a simple holiday tale, capturing the essence of generosity, hope, and community, all anchored around the iconic Rockefeller Center Christmas tree. 🎄

As you delve into the pages of this beautifully illustrated book, you will find yourself transported to a time when the world grappled with the Great Depression. The backdrop of hardship is palpable, yet Rubel paints it with strokes of resilience and kindness. His storytelling is akin to a warm embrace, inviting readers, young and old, to reflect on the importance of giving and togetherness during the festive season.

In this enchanting tale, the story revolves around a carpenter who, facing his own challenges, discovers the transformative power of hope and compassion. It's a narrative rooted in historical context, yet it resonates deeply with our current times. The gift of the Christmas tree embodies a gesture that ignites joy and camaraderie in a world that often seems fractured. This tree isn't merely an ornament; it's a symbol of dreams and a beacon of light during the darkest days.

The illustrations play a crucial role in conveying the emotional depth of the story. Each page is a visual feast that complements the heartfelt prose, inviting readers into a whimsical winter wonderland where magic and miracles wait to unfold. You'll find yourself captivated not just by the story, but by the artistry that breathes life into it.

Readers have shared a mosaic of reactions to Rubel's poignant narrative. Some admire how the book emphasizes unyielding hope, particularly in tumultuous times. Others have expressed a profound appreciation for the way it evokes nostalgia-reminding them of the joys of their own childhood Christmases. Yet, there are critiques, primarily focusing on the simplicity of the storyline. However, isn't that exactly what makes it brilliant? The straightforward narrative allows the deeper themes to shine, and in doing so, it captures the pure essence of holiday spirit-accessible to all.
